單項選擇題對n個元素的有序表A[1..n]進(jìn)行二分(折半)查找,則成功查找到表中的任意一個元素時,最多與A中的()元素進(jìn)行比較。

A.n-1
B.n/2
C.(log2n)-1
D.(log2n)+1


你可能感興趣的試題

1.單項選擇題以下關(guān)于哈希表的敘述中,錯誤的是()。

A.哈希表中元素的存儲位置根據(jù)該元素的關(guān)鍵字值計算得到
B.哈希表中的元素越多,插入一新元素時發(fā)生沖突的可能性就越小
C.哈希表中的元素越多,插入一個新元素時發(fā)生沖突的可能性就越大
D.哈希表中插入新元素發(fā)生沖突時,需要與表中某些元素進(jìn)行比較

2.單項選擇題以下關(guān)于程序流程圖、N-S盒圖和決策表的敘述中,錯誤的是()。

A.N-S盒圖可以避免隨意的控制轉(zhuǎn)移
B.N-S盒圖可以同時表示程序邏輯和數(shù)據(jù)結(jié)構(gòu)
C.程序流程圖中的控制流可以任意轉(zhuǎn)向
D.決策表適宜表示多重條件組合下的行為

最新試題

以下應(yīng)用中,必須采用棧結(jié)構(gòu)的是()。

題型:單項選擇題

對于二維數(shù)組a[1..6,1..8],設(shè)每個元素占2個存儲單元,且以列為主序存儲,則元素a[4,4]相對于數(shù)組空間起始地址的偏移量是()個存儲單元。

題型:單項選擇題

空白(1)處應(yīng)選擇()

題型:單項選擇題

若在單向鏈表上,除訪問鏈表中所有節(jié)點外,還需在表尾頻繁插入節(jié)點,那么采用()最節(jié)省時間。

題型:單項選擇題

許多工作需要用曲線來擬合平面上一批離散的點,以便于直觀了解趨勢,也便于插值和預(yù)測。例如,對平面上給定的n個離散點{(Xi,Yi)i=1,…,n},先依次將每4個點分成一組,并且前一組的尾就是后一組的首;再對每一組的4個點,確定一段多項式函數(shù)曲線使其通過這些點。一般來說,通過給定的4個點可以確定一條()次多項式函數(shù)曲線恰好通過這4個點。

題型:單項選擇題

沒A是n*n常數(shù)矩陣(n>1),X是由未知數(shù)X1,X2,…,Xn組成的列向量,B是由常數(shù)b1,b2,…,bn組成的列向量,線性方程組AX=B有唯一解的充分必要條件不是()。

題型:單項選擇題

某二叉樹為單枝樹(即非葉子節(jié)點只有一個孩子節(jié)點)且具有n個節(jié)點(n>1)則該二叉樹()。

題型:單項選擇題

閱讀以下說明和流程圖,將應(yīng)填入____處的字句寫在答題紙的對應(yīng)欄內(nèi)。下面的流程圖旨在統(tǒng)計指定關(guān)鍵詞在某一篇文章中出現(xiàn)的次數(shù)。設(shè)這篇文章由字符A(0),…,A(n-1)依次組成,指定關(guān)鍵詞由字符B(0),…,B(m-1)依次組成,其中n>m≥1。注意,關(guān)鍵詞的各次出現(xiàn)不允許有交叉重疊。例如,在"aaaa"中只出現(xiàn)兩次"aa"。該流程圖采用的算法是:在字符串A中,從左到右尋找與字符串B相匹配的并且沒有交叉重疊的所有子串。流程圖8-17中,i為字符串A中當(dāng)前正在進(jìn)行比較的動態(tài)子串首字符的下標(biāo),j為字符串B的下標(biāo),k為指定關(guān)鍵詞出現(xiàn)的次數(shù)。

題型:問答題

當(dāng)遇到哪幾種條件組合時,流程圖能執(zhí)行"1→i"?(寫出相應(yīng)的序號即呵)

題型:問答題

空白(2)處應(yīng)選擇()

題型:單項選擇題